IBM announced today that it will acquire Enterprise Content Management vendor FileNet. Over time, this could change the EED landscape. 

Enterprise content management, which increasingly includes records management, is becoming the arena of major corporations. (For example, see my blog post about CA acquiring MDY.) As big companies gain control over the life cycle and storage locations of their information, the e-discovery landscape is sure to change. Exactly how, however, remains to be seen but I suspect pure e-discovery providers, especially those focused on collecting and processing data, will eventually have to develop new offerings to thrive and grow.
